noggin in a sentence
n.
Definition
NOGGIN: a colloquial term for the head or the mind.
Sample Sentences
- I bumped my noggin on the low ceiling while trying to stand up.
- After a long day at work, all I wanted was to relax and clear my noggin of stress.
- He often jokes that his noggin is filled with random trivia and useless facts.
- The little boy wore a helmet to protect his noggin while riding his bike.
- She couldn’t believe how much information her noggin could retain for the exam.
